can any body clesrly explain about types of query
subjects.that is data source query subject,model query
subject,stored procedure query subjects?



can any body clesrly explain about types of query subjects.that is data source query subject,model..

Answer / sunitha

Three types of query subjects are there:
1.default datasource querysubject
2.model querysubjects
3.stored procedure querysubjects.

1.Datasource querysubject:-Datasoure query subjects contain
sql statements that directly reference data in a single
datasource.Framework manager automatically creates a
datasource querysubject for each table and view that you
import into model.

2.Model querysubjects:-Querysubjects which created from
model (querysubjects & queryitems)sources are called model
querysubjects.

3.Stored procedures:-Querysubjects which created from Stored
procedures are called Stored procedure querysubjects.
